PaddockLad 19802 Posted 8 hours ago Share Posted 8 hours ago I’ve done the survey In conjunction with the FAB they’ve decided to upgrade the current badge and there’s a video explaining what each component part represents ie castle, lion/flag, sea horses, scroll with club name etc… so then they ask which of the components you think would be the most important on any new badge. They’re going to come up with a range of choices after this excercise then they’ll be a vote. Fairly sure any new design won’t be on next season’s strip but happy to be corrected by those who may know better.
